#449b68 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#449b68 is composed of 26.7% red, 60.8% green and 40.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 56.1% cyan, 0% magenta, 32.9% yellow and 39.2% black. It has a hue angle of 144.8 degrees, a saturation of 39% and a lightness of 43.7%. #449b68 color hex could be obtained by blending #88ffd0 with #003700. Closest websafe color is: #339966.

#449b68 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#449b68 has RGB values of R:68, G:155, B:104 and CMYK values of C:0.56, M:0, Y:0.33, K:0.39. Its decimal value is 4496232.

Shades and Tints of #449b68
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020503 is the darkest color, while #f6fbf8 is the lightest one.
